Perioperative Practitioners play an important role in maintaining these standards and ensuring patient satisfaction by providing specialist support in the areas of scrub, anaesthetic and recovery to consultants and the theatre team.
A number of our theatre practitioners have secured Theatre Manager posts and we are very keen to encourage this progression.
Working side by side with some of the UKs top consultants you will support a wide range of surgical procedures due to the complexity of services offered by Spire hospitals. These may include cardiac, bariatrics, oncology, ophthalmology. gastrointestinal, neurosurgery and gynaecology, as well as orthopaedics and general surgery. Ideally you will provide support in all 3 areas of scrub, anaesthetics and recovery, or you may have chosen to specialise in one of these areas.

Training and Development
Your training starts on the day you join with a comprehensive induction programme, and leads on to mandatory training including infection control and core clinical training and medical device competencies. You can look forward to further training in immediate and acute illness management, critical care competencies and where appropriate advanced life support. We offer a fast track Perioperative BSc (Hons) degree programme through which you will be offered accredited modules in law, research, advanced scrub practitioner skills, work based learning, service development, reflective practice and research practice. Alternatively, you may wish to substitute scrub practitioner skills for recovery or anaesthetic practice.

What we are looking for
You will be a Registered Nurse or an Operating Department Practitioner ideally working towards a post registration qualification. You will have experience of working in teams and working with minimum supervision. Ideally you will have experience of applying clinical reasoning skills to a range of complex and varied patient case mixes, although we often have vacancies for newly qualified practitioners.
